For years, Islam Makhachev ruled the UFC lightweight division. His technical prowess, relentless wrestling, and tactical mind earned him the longest lightweight title reign in the promotion’s history. Fans witnessed a series of skilled performances as he defended his belt against top contenders and extended his winning streak, cementing his legacy among the lightweight greats.
While many speculated about his next challenge, the announcement of his departure from the 155-pound division was monumental. According to MMA Fighting, Islam Makhachev is officially relinquishing his lightweight title to pursue welterweight gold. The decision came after his friend and training partner, Belal Muhammad, lost the welterweight belt, clearing the path for a new era.
Details of Makhachev’s ambitions to move up didn’t come as a surprise to those close to him. In fact, teammate Josh Thomson recently revealed that Makhachev had been considering this move for nearly eight years. On the Bloody Elbow podcast, Thomson mentioned, "He’s been talking about for a long time just getting tired of cutting the weight."
Islam Makhachev’s next challenge is already creating buzz. UFC CEO Dana White announced the highly anticipated showdown between Makhachev and welterweight champion Jack Della Maddalena. This upcoming fight is considered by many fans and experts as a true superfight. According to an article in the Times of India, both fighters have verbally agreed to face off, and the bout is expected to take place later this year.
This isn’t just a battle for a new belt; it is the pursuit of UFC history. Makhachev seeks to become a two-division champion, a feat achieved by only a handful of elite fighters.
As Islam vacates his lightweight crown, the division moves forward. A new champion will soon be crowned, with Charles Oliveira set to face Ilia Topuria for the vacant belt. Meanwhile, the welterweight showdown between Makhachev and Della Maddalena promises fireworks and global intrigue.
